Company Description

RIVO is seeking an experienced, hands-on IT Manager to lead our IT operations and infrastructure while remaining actively involved in day-to-day support and technology management.

This is not a role where you'll simply delegate work from behind a desk. We're looking for a leader who enjoys rolling up their sleeves, solving problems, supporting end users, and working alongside their team. You'll oversee our technology infrastructure, network security, cloud platforms, and hardware environment while helping ensure our employees have the tools and support they need to succeed.

You'll partner closely with leadership to maintain a secure, scalable, and reliable technology environment while managing a small IT team and helping shape the future of our technology operations.

Job Description

What You’ll Do

Leadership & Team Management

  • Lead, mentor, and develop IT team members while establishing priorities and managing workflow
  • Participate in interviewing, hiring, onboarding, and training new IT staff
  • Conduct performance evaluations, coaching conversations, and employee development planning
  • Serve as an escalation point for technical issues requiring advanced troubleshooting

Infrastructure & Operations

  • Manage and maintain company hardware, software, operating systems, and network infrastructure
  • Perform hands‑on setup and troubleshooting of workstations, laptops, monitors, docking stations, and peripherals
  • Configure and deploy technology for new hires and office expansions
  • Monitor system performance, availability, and reliability across all environments
  • Manage user provisioning, access controls, onboarding, and offboarding processes
  • Maintain accurate inventories, documentation, warranties, licensing, and asset records

Security & Compliance

  • Maintain and strengthen network and system security through firewalls, access controls, monitoring, backups, and recovery processes
  • Monitor for security threats, investigate incidents, and implement corrective actions
  • Support business continuity and disaster recovery planning efforts
  • Ensure company technology environments align with security best practices
  • Administer Microsoft 365 technologies, including Entra ID, Intune, Azure, and related services
  • Support and maintain LAN, WAN, VPN, wireless, and cloud network environments
  • Manage Fortinet firewalls, switches, wireless infrastructure, and site‑to‑site connectivity
  • Perform upgrades, maintenance, patching, and ongoing optimization of infrastructure systems
  • Manage relationships with technology vendors and service providers
  • Assist with budgeting, purchasing decisions, and technology planning
  • Partner with business leaders to identify technology solutions that improve operational efficiency
  • Maintain comprehensive system documentation, policies, procedures, and internal knowledge base resources
Qualifications

What We Look For

  • 5+ years of experience in systems administration and network administration within a Microsoft environment
    2+ years of supervisory, lead, or management experience
    Strong experience supporting Microsoft 365, Entra ID, Intune, Azure, and Windows Server environments
    Experience managing Fortinet or similar enterprise networking and security platforms
    Strong understanding of networking concepts including DNS, DHCP, VPNs, LAN/WAN infrastructure, routing, and firewall management
    Experience with endpoint management, patching, backup solutions, and disaster recovery practices
    Demonstrated ability to troubleshoot complex technical issues from start to finish
    Strong communication, organizational, and project management skills
    Ability to balance strategic planning with hands‑on technical execution

Preferred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field preferred
  • Equivalent combination of education and relevant experience will be considered
  • Microsoft 365 Certified: Administrator Expert or similar certification preferred
  • Experience supporting technology in a call center or high-volume operational environment strongly preferred
